Summary Explanation/Background

THE PUBLIC WORKS AND ENVIRONMENTAL SERVICES DEPARTMENT, AND THE HOUSING AND URBAN PLANNING DIVISION RECOMMEND APPROVAL OF THE ABOVE MOTION, subject to staff recommendations and conditions which will ensure compliance with the standards and requirements of Chapter 5, Article IX of the Broward County Code of Ordinances.

 

This plat is located on 15.79 acres between Northwest 13 Street and Northwest 15 Street, and between State Road 7/U.S. 441 and Northwest 36 Way, in the City of Lauderhill. The plat is currently restricted to 144 garden apartments, 214 midrise units and 2,870 square feet of daycare use on Tract 1; the remainder of the plat is restricted to 66,408 square feet of telecommunications equipment.

 

The applicant is requesting to amend the note on the face of the plat to read as follows: The plat is restricted to 388 midrise units and 2,870 square feet of daycare use on Tract 1; the remainder of the plat is restricted to 66,408 square feet of telecommunications equipment.

 

The proposed development is consistent with the permitted uses under the effective land use plan. As such, it is not subject to Policy 2.16.2 of the Broward County Land Use Plan.
